--- Comment #4 from Mitchell Horne <mhorne@freebsd.org> ---
Might be worth noting that modern libc has a VDSO implementation of
clock_gettime(3), under which CLOCK_MONOTONIC and the _FAST variant behave
identically (see the switch statement in lib/libc/sys/__vdso_gettimeofday.c).

It seems likely that for any system interested in running X11, this patch will
be a no-op. This may include the system you tested on, unless you made specific
provisions against this. This is merely a passing observation; I'm not
nay-saying the patch.
